We installed our own solar panels on our roof several years ago, and probably long before most people even thought about using solar panels to save money on electricity. We use solar panels to heat our swimming pool in our home. The panels provide a nice warm temperature in our home pool, and we pay absolutely no money per month or year to get this needed heat for our pool. Without the solar panels, we would not have a suitable water temperature for swimming, and we would probably never use our pool.
The solar panels on our roof provide the energy that we need to heat our pool, and more importantly, they provide a comfortable water temperature. It is so comfortable, if fact, that we use our pool often, and we do not have to worry about the high costs of other types of heating possibilities, though we maintain our dual fuel tariff for the household energy supplier.
When or pool was added to our home, we did pay an electrician to install the electrical apparatus that is necessary to operate the solar system. It was part of the initial price of the pool's installation, and having it done at that time was cost efficient. As far as the installation of the actual solar panels on our roof, we did that job ourselves. It was done by two of us, and while it may have taken longer to do it ourselves, it was really not that diffficult of a project. The worst part was getting on and off the roof to actually do the job. Doing the work ourselves was well worth the effort for us.
We have had to do a few repairs on the system over the years. We have also had to replace a panel or two, and we have had to replace connectors and pipes occasionally. This happens when the sun beats down on any roof, but it isn't much work to do the maintenance part of the job, either. Solar panels and the electricity they provide for our pool has been well worth the initial cost, effort, and maintenance.
